Texting that is. For those of you with experience in employees, how do you handle your staff concerning texting. This is a very real problem wih some people, it's an addiction and it costs... big time... so how did you handle it?

Our employee handbook, which they have to sign in agreement at time of hire, states that cell/text use any time other than at breaks is grounds for termination.

If someone has to call them for an emergency, they can be contacted through the company line.

Same thing Here.. When I had Employees. All Cell Phones were to be left in your Car..If you went out on a Job You Grabbed one of the Shops Cells and when I checked the Call logs and I saw personal calls we had a talk..

Solid and Simple Rule Posted.. "You want paid for 8 hours you Work for 8 hours"

The worst were some of my Designers.. I would catch them using Chat on the computers. I finally just blocked all internet access on all computers except mine.
